Optimal performance in every climate condition
Variations in environmental conditions, such as nighttime temperature changes or traversing a tunnel in the winter season, can create condensation or ice on sensors. This can temporarily affect the sensors’ ability to provide precise data, compromising the safety of the vehicle and its occupants. Thanks to the ability to maintain an optimal temperature, ALPER Flexible Resistances contribute to preserving the performance of sensors and cameras even in the most extreme weather conditions. The result? An ADAS system that operates reliably and safely, regardless of atmospheric adversities.
